Mark Swed mentions Colin Davis, David Cairns and Hugh Macdonald for taking credit for the Berlioz revival in the late ‘50s (“A Bull Market for Berlioz,” March 16).

He omitted another very influential person who preceded them. In 1950, the eminent cultural historian, scholar and author Jacques Barzun wrote a monumental two-volume biography of Berlioz, “Berlioz and the Romantic Century.” Barzun has always been a champion and booster of Berlioz’s music. He felt that its worth was not fully understood by critics and public alike.
